Gina Acosta@ginacostag_ · Jul 27A vendor claimed their API was 40x faster than the competition. The number was real. The comparison wasn't. I write about AI infrastructure and build the explainer graphics people actually bookmark. My whole job is checking the number before it goes on a chart. Every launch ships a benchmark now. Almost none ship the methodology. To know if a claim is honest, you have to dig: → what was actually measured → on what hardware, at what payload → whether competitors were configured fairly, or just quoted off their own marketing pages That's an afternoon. Per claim. So for a while, I skipped the technical comparisons. Not worth the time. Which meant the best posts went to people just restating the press release. Now an AI employee does that legwork. He pulls: - the published numbers - the methodology (if one exists) - the changelog - what competitors claim in their own docs Then lays it all side by side with the gaps marked. Last week: a latency claim of 62ms vs. a field quoted at 244ms–2.6s. The 62ms was real. Reproducible. But: → 62ms was measured on cached queries → competitor numbers were cold starts, lifted straight from marketing pages Like for like? The real gap was ~3x. Not 40x. Still a good number. Just not the headline. That mismatch became the graphic. He assembles. I verify every source. Then it ships. The bottleneck in technical content was never the design.
